Solution for 73+(x-5)+(2x+2)=180 equation:



73+(x-5)+(2x+2)=180
We move all terms to the left:
73+(x-5)+(2x+2)-(180)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
(x-5)+(2x+2)-107=0
We get rid of parentheses
x+2x-5+2-107=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
3x-110=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
3x=110
x=110/3
x=36+2/3
